Abstract
In this paper the history of channel speed development of optical transport networks, from a few MbI/s to beyond 100 GbI/s, is reviewed. A new channel type categorization, which divided various channel designs into only three basic channel types, has been proposed. Based on the new categorization distinguishable performances of the three types of channels are analyzed and the future direction of optical channel designs is predicted.
